Transaction 38d848619d5e4826d9a995325c8f529be619438781ac076c176acdcf8e70db50
1 Input
2 Outputs
- 38d848619d5e4826d9a995325c8f529be619438781ac076c176acdcf8e70db50:0
- 38d848619d5e4826d9a995325c8f529be619438781ac076c176acdcf8e70db50:1
value 2483
address 17Paefcm8eSBdG4GTFkTPmtwoVowoLD4E2
value 2157988
address 3FzrimqZFBfpWggMEqh8Jz41QK6FsvuYsQ